PLC編程學習其實是一個循序漸進的過程,它需要你從基礎的理論知識開始,逐步深入到實踐應用中。下面我為你概述一下PLC編程學習的具體步驟:理解基礎概念:首先,你需要對PLC(可編程邏輯控制器)有一個基本的了解。這包括了解它的定義、功能、應用領域以及它在工業(yè)自動化中的作用。學習編程語言:PLC通常使用特定的編程語言,如梯形圖、功能塊圖或結(jié)構(gòu)化文本等。你需要熟悉這些編程語言的基本語法和規(guī)則。掌握硬件知識:PLC與各種傳感器、執(zhí)行器和其他設備相連,因此你需要了解這些硬件的工作原理和接口方式。學習編程工具:為了編寫和調(diào)試PLC程序,你需要使用專門的編程工具。這些工具通常包括模擬器、調(diào)試器和編程軟件等。你需要學會如何使用這些工具來創(chuàng)建、測試和修改PLC程序。實踐應用:理論知識是基礎,但真正的學習需要在實踐中進行。你可以通過參與項目、解決實際問題或進行模擬實驗等方式來應用你的PLC編程技能。持續(xù)學習和提升:PLC技術不斷發(fā)展和更新,因此你需要保持持續(xù)學習的態(tài)度。你可以通過閱讀技術文檔、參加培訓課程或參與技術社區(qū)等方式來不斷提升自己的PLC編程能力。記住,PLC編程學習是一個長期的過程,需要耐心和毅力。只要你持之以恒地學習和實踐。 學習PLC編程,讓你的職業(yè)生涯更加精彩紛呈。陽江附近PLC編程培訓有哪些
在PLC(可編程邏輯控制器)編程中,模塊化編程思想的應用非常廣,它極大地提高了編程效率、可維護性和可重用性。下面,我將通過一個具體的案例來描述模塊化編程思想在PLC編程中的實際應用。假設我們有一個復雜的自動化生產(chǎn)線,該生產(chǎn)線包括多個不同的模塊,如物料輸送模塊、加工模塊、檢測模塊和包裝模塊等。每個模塊都有自己特定的功能和操作邏輯。在這個場景下,我們可以采用模塊化編程思想來組織PLC程序。首先,我們可以為每個模塊定義一個單獨的子程序或功能塊。例如,物料輸送模塊可以有一個名為“MaterialHandling”的子程序,它包含了控制物料輸送的所有邏輯和指令。同樣地,加工模塊、檢測模塊和包裝模塊也可以有各自對應的子程序。在主程序中,我們只需要調(diào)用這些子程序即可實現(xiàn)整個生產(chǎn)線的控制。當物料輸送到加工模塊時,主程序會調(diào)用“MaterialHandling”子程序?qū)⑽锪陷斔偷街付ㄎ恢?,然后調(diào)用加工模塊的子程序進行加工操作。加工完成后,再調(diào)用檢測模塊的子程序進行檢測,調(diào)用包裝模塊的子程序進行包裝。通過模塊化編程,我們可以將復雜的控制邏輯分解為多個簡單的模塊,每個模塊都可以**設計、測試和調(diào)試。這樣不僅可以提高編程效率。 韶關本地PLC編程培訓費用是多少PLC編程中的中斷和事件處理機制,是實現(xiàn)復雜控制邏輯的關鍵。
在PLC編程培訓中,加強學員的實踐能力是至關重要的。我們可以通過以下幾個步驟來確保學員們能夠?qū)⑺鶎W知識應用于實際中:首先,為學員們提供充足的實驗和實操環(huán)境。通過搭建與工業(yè)現(xiàn)場相似的實操平臺,學員們可以模擬真實的PLC控制過程。這樣,他們可以在實踐中學習和掌握PLC編程的各個環(huán)節(jié),如程序編寫、調(diào)試和故障排查等。其次,鼓勵學員們參與實際項目。在培訓過程中,我們可以引導學員們參與一些實際的項目案例。通過參與這些項目,學員們可以將所學知識應用于實際情境中,提高自己的實踐能力和解決問題的能力。同時,加強校企合作也是提高學員實踐能力的重要途徑。我們可以與相關企業(yè)建立合作關系,為學員們提供實習機會。在實習過程中,學員們可以接觸到真實的工作環(huán)境和實際任務,通過實踐來檢驗自己的學習成果,提高自己的專業(yè)素養(yǎng)和綜合能力。此外,我們還可以組織一些競賽和實踐活動,如PLC編程競賽、工業(yè)自動化實踐周等。這些活動可以激發(fā)學員們的學習興趣和動力,讓他們在競爭和合作中提高自己的實踐能力和團隊協(xié)作能力??傊?,在PLC編程培訓中加強學員的實踐能力需要多方面的努力。
在PLC編程中,優(yōu)化中斷和事件處理效率是確保系統(tǒng)高效、穩(wěn)定運行的關鍵。以下是一些建議,幫助你在這方面做得更好:明確需求:首先,明確你的系統(tǒng)需要處理哪些中斷和事件。了解這些中斷和事件的觸發(fā)條件、頻率以及重要性。優(yōu)先級管理:為中斷和事件設置優(yōu)先級。確保高優(yōu)先級的中斷和事件能夠優(yōu)先被處理??焖夙憫罕M量減少中斷和事件處理的延遲時間。優(yōu)化代碼,確保在中斷或事件觸發(fā)時,系統(tǒng)能夠迅速響應。避免阻塞:避免在中斷或事件處理過程中執(zhí)行耗時或阻塞性的操作??梢钥紤]使用異步處理或后臺任務來處理這些操作。減少抖動:如果可能的話,減少中斷或事件的抖動(即短時間內(nèi)頻繁觸發(fā))。這可以通過設置適當?shù)拈撝祷蜓訒r來實現(xiàn)。中斷合并:如果多個中斷或事件具有相似的處理邏輯,可以考慮將它們合并成一個中斷或事件來處理。這可以減少代碼的復雜性并提高處理效率。中斷屏蔽:在處理一個中斷或事件時,屏蔽其他不必要的中斷或事件。這可以防止其他中斷或事件干擾當前的處理過程。使用中斷隊列:如果中斷或事件觸發(fā)頻繁,可以使用中斷隊列來管理它們。這可以確保所有的中斷或事件都得到處理,而不會遺漏。測試和驗證:在實際應用之前。 在學習PLC編程時,要注意各種指令的用途和區(qū)別,以免在實際應用中出錯。
PLC編程,作為工業(yè)自動化領域的關鍵技能,對于個人職業(yè)發(fā)展有著不可忽視的積極影響。掌握這一技能,無疑會為您的職業(yè)道路增添更多可能性。首先,PLC編程是工業(yè)自動化領域的基石。隨著科技的進步和制造業(yè)的飛速發(fā)展,越來越多的企業(yè)開始注重生產(chǎn)效率和成本控制。而PLC編程正是實現(xiàn)這一目標的關鍵技術之一。掌握PLC編程,意味著您能夠參與到這些企業(yè)的重要項目中,為企業(yè)創(chuàng)造價值,從而獲得更多的職業(yè)機會和晉升空間。其次,PLC編程具有廣泛的應用領域。從傳統(tǒng)的制造業(yè)到新興的物聯(lián)網(wǎng)、人工智能等領域,PLC編程都發(fā)揮著重要作用。因此,掌握PLC編程將使您具備跨行業(yè)就業(yè)的能力,拓寬您的職業(yè)道路。再者,PLC編程是一項具有挑戰(zhàn)性的工作。在編程過程中,您需要不斷學習新知識、解決新問題,這將鍛煉您的邏輯思維能力和創(chuàng)新能力。同時,與團隊成員的緊密合作也將提高您的團隊協(xié)作能力和溝通能力,為您的職業(yè)發(fā)展奠定堅實基礎。總之,掌握PLC編程對個人職業(yè)發(fā)展具有積極影響。它不僅能幫助您實現(xiàn)職業(yè)晉升和跨界就業(yè),還能鍛煉您的能力和技能。因此,我建議您積極學習PLC編程知識,不斷提升自己的競爭力。 無論你是學生還是職場人士,PLC培訓都能為你帶來無限可能。重慶西門子PLC編程培訓機構(gòu)
不斷挑戰(zhàn)自己,嘗試編寫更復雜的PLC程序,以提升自己的編程能力和技術水平。陽江附近PLC編程培訓有哪些
在PLC編程的領域中,中斷和事件處理機制確實是實現(xiàn)復雜控制邏輯的關鍵部分。中斷功能允許PLC在特定事件發(fā)生時立即停止當前任務,轉(zhuǎn)而處理該事件,之后再繼續(xù)執(zhí)行原任務。這種即時的響應能力對于需要快速處理緊急情況的控制系統(tǒng)至關重要。而事件處理機制,則是針對特定事件定義的一系列操作或邏輯流程。當這些事件被PLC檢測到時,便會觸發(fā)相應的處理流程。比如,當某個傳感器檢測到異常信號時,PLC可以通過事件處理機制來觸發(fā)警報、記錄數(shù)據(jù)或采取其他應對措施。在編寫PLC程序時,我們需要深入理解這些機制的工作原理,并巧妙地將它們?nèi)谌氲娇刂七壿嬛小_@樣,我們才能設計出既穩(wěn)定又高效的控制系統(tǒng),以滿足各種復雜的應用需求。陽江附近PLC編程培訓有哪些